The two State Troopers that were injured in a crash on the New York State Thruway, remain hospitalized in serious but stable condition. Both have had surgery. The Troopers were assisting several tow truck operators in removing a disabled vehicle from the median when a car crashed into the troopers’ car and a tow truck. The operator of the vehicle, 26-year-old Christopher Neumann, was charged with Driving While Intoxicated and other charges.
